Mean
The arithmetic average of a set of numbers, found by dividing the sum of these numbers by the count of the numbers in the set.
Function
A relationship between a set of inputs and a set of permissible outputs, where each input is related to exactly one output.
Probability
The measure of the likelihood that an event will occur.
